Key Findings

• CMS rates this facility 2/5 stars (below average)

• Has 120 certified beds with an average of 100.8 residents per day (84% occupancy)

• Last health inspection found 6 deficiencies (inspected Jun 27, 2025)

• Has been fined a total of $109,995 across 4 fine(s)

• Total nursing staff: 3.02 hours per resident per day

• Staff turnover rate: 46.1%

• Part of the Wellsential Health chain (67 facilities)

Houston Heights Nursing and Rehabilitation Center is a 2-star Medicare and Medicaid certified nursing home in Houston, Texas with 120 certified beds. It has been operating since 2013. The facility scored below average compared to Texas facilities.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the CMS rating for Houston Heights Nursing and Rehabilitation Center?▾
Houston Heights Nursing and Rehabilitation Center has an overall CMS rating of 2 out of 5 stars, with a health inspection rating of 2/5, staffing rating of 2/5, and quality measures rating of 4/5. This facility is rated below average.
Has Houston Heights Nursing and Rehabilitation Center had any health inspection violations?▾
Houston Heights Nursing and Rehabilitation Center had 6 deficiency citations in its most recent health inspection (Jun 27, 2025). The facility has been fined a total of $109,995 across 4 fine(s). It also has 2 infection control citation(s).
What are the staffing levels at Houston Heights Nursing and Rehabilitation Center?▾
Houston Heights Nursing and Rehabilitation Center provides 3.02 total nursing staff hours per resident per day, including 0.33 RN hours, 0.86 LPN hours, and 1.83 nurse aide hours. The total staff turnover rate is 46.1%.
How many beds does Houston Heights Nursing and Rehabilitation Center have?▾
Houston Heights Nursing and Rehabilitation Center has 120 certified beds with an average of 100.8 residents per day, resulting in approximately 84% occupancy. The facility is Non profit - Corporation owned and is part of the Wellsential Health chain.
